China’s top industry officials have vowed to curb low-price competition and excess capacity in the solar sector, as authorities begin implementing measures aimed at stabilizing supply chains and rebalancing the market.
Deye has developed a new power conversion system (PCS) optimized for solar integration, with modules ranging from 100 kW to 125 kW. The Chinese manufacturer says the PCS supports flexible system design and targets commercial and industrial (C&I) applications.
WHES has launched a new series of commercial and industrial (C&I) storage systems with integrated hybrid inverters, offering capacities from 57 kWh to 100 kWh and PV input up to 96 kW. The China-based manufacturer claims the systems support 200% PV overloading.
The China Nonferrous Metals Industry Association (CNMIA) says polysilicon prices fell as low as $4.74/kg this week, with only 11 producers currently operating at reduced capacity.
GoodWe has launched a 112 kWh battery storage system for commercial and industrial (C&I) solar projects, featuring 96% round-trip efficiency and a 6,000-cycle lifespan. The system allows parallel connection for up to 450 kWh of total capacity.
China’s solar power capacity has surpassed 1 TW, marking a historic milestone as the country accelerates its energy transition. Around 92 GW of new PV systems were installed in China in May alone, but analysts warn the pace may slow in the second half of the year.
Scientists in China have outlined a mission proposal for the China Academy of Space Technology space solar power (SSP) development program. It includes three solar arrays, microwave power transmission, and laser power transmission. The roadmap predicts this demonstration mission cound be attempted before 2030.

Solar manufacturers signed an estimated 15 GW of module sales and supply deals at SNEC 2025 PV Expo in Shanghai last week. Major contracts included JinkoSolar’s 1.75 GW order for Saudi Arabia’s SPPC project and JA Solar’s 2 GW agreement to support solar manufacturing in India.
An international research team has used Lewis molecules to improve efficiency and stability of a perovskite solar cell built with a fully encapsulated trapping tactic aimed to reduce perovskite surface defects. The cell achieved a certified power conversion efficiency of 25.18% and a champion efficiency of 25.37%.
